Time Off Management
The ClarityLoop HRIS (HR+) Time Off workspace handles leave types, balances, approvals and company-wide calendars in one place. Policies are flexible enough to cover paid, unpaid and compensatory leave while keeping balances accurate.

1. Configure leave types
- Go to Time Off › Leave Types and click Create.
- Key fields:
- Name & Colour – Friendly label and calendar colour.
- Is Paid – Choose
PaidorUnpaidto drive payroll reporting. - Limit Leave Days – Toggle off if the leave should be unlimited; otherwise specify the total days.
- Reset – Enable to refresh balances automatically (Yearly, Monthly or Weekly with a specific day).
- Carry Forward – Pick the carry-forward model (none, unlimited, or expiring with a limit and expiry period).
- Require Approval / Attachment – Force approvals or supporting documents where needed.
- Exclude Company Holidays / Leaves – Decide whether those days should reduce the requested duration.
- Encashable – Flag leave that can be converted into reimbursements via Payroll.
- Assign employees while creating or editing the leave type. HR+ will create matching records in Balances for each selected employee.
2. Allocate and adjust balances
- Use Time Off › Balances to edit individual balances (e.g. grant extra days or reduce a balance after manual adjustments).
- Bulk filters let you focus on a single leave type, employment type or custom tag before exporting.
- Historical allocations remain visible so you can track when and by whom balances were changed.
Employees can also request extra allocations through Extra Leave Requests. Approving the request automatically increases their balance and logs the approver.
3. Manage leave requests
For employees
- Open My Time Off and click Create.
- Choose the leave type, date range (full or half days), add supporting comments and attach files if required by policy.
- Requests appear with status
Requesteduntil reviewed.
For approvers/HR
- Review requests in Requests. Filters make it easy to work by manager, timeframe or any custom tags you use to organise your team.
- Change the status to
Approved,RejectedorCancelled. Approval follows the routing rules set in the leave type (multiple approvers, reporting manager, etc.). - Approved requests automatically deduct from the employee’s balance and update the calendar.
- Use the action menu to download attachments, add comments or edit details (subject to permissions).
4. Maintain company calendars
- Holidays – Manage region/company-specific holidays that apply to everyone.
- Company Days Off – Create mandatory company-wide time off (e.g. company shutdown days). Requests cannot be submitted for these dates when the leave type is configured to exclude them.
- Restricted Dates – Block specific days or periods where time off cannot be requested (for example, quarter close). Restrictions show directly in the employee request flow.
5. Compensatory leave (optional)
When Attendance is active, overtime validations can be converted into compensatory leave:
- Employees submit requests under Time Off in Lieu.
- Managers validate the associated attendance entries.
- Approved requests create an allocation in Balances for the compensatory leave type.
Best practices
- Configure notification emails/alerts from the Attendance workspace if you rely on check-in data to drive approvals.
- Review the dashboard weekly—widgets highlight pending approvals, upcoming restricted days and habitually late returns.
- Use consistent naming and colours for leave types so the combined calendar is easy to read.
- Remind employees to cancel leave they no longer need; balances update instantly and keep your payroll accruals accurate.
